메뉴 건너뛰기




Volumn 2, Issue 2, 2011, Pages 105-112

WaLBerla: HPC software design for computational engineering simulations

Author keywords

Lattice Boltzmann method; MPI; Software Engineering; Software Quality

Indexed keywords

COMPUTATIONAL ENGINEERING; EXPANDABILITY; HETEROGENEOUS COMPUTATION; LATTICE BOLTZMANN; LATTICE-BOLTZMANN METHOD; MPI; PARALLEL SOFTWARE FRAMEWORK; PHYSICAL PHENOMENA; SOFTWARE QUALITY;

EID: 79958767410     PISSN: 18777503     EISSN: None     Source Type: Journal    
DOI: 10.1016/j.jocs.2011.01.004     Document Type: Article
Times cited : (94)

References (45)
  • 2
    • 79958771518 scopus 로고    scopus 로고
    • Simulation of floating objects in free-surface flow, Diploma Thesis, January
    • S. Bogner, Simulation of floating objects in free-surface flow, Diploma Thesis, January 2009.
    • (2009)
    • Bogner, S.1
  • 3
    • 79958766614 scopus 로고    scopus 로고
    • Simulation of clotting processes using non-Newtonian blood models and the Lattice Boltzmann method
    • Master's Thesis, February
    • D. Haspel, Simulation of clotting processes using non-Newtonian blood models and the Lattice Boltzmann method, Master's Thesis, February 2009.
    • (2009)
    • Haspel, D.1
  • 4
    • 77549086134 scopus 로고    scopus 로고
    • Coupling multibody dynamics and computational fluid dynamics on 8192 processor cores
    • Götz J., Iglberger K., Feichtinger C., Donath S., Rüde U. Coupling multibody dynamics and computational fluid dynamics on 8192 processor cores. Parallel Computing 2010, 36(2-3):142-151.
    • (2010) Parallel Computing , vol.36 , Issue.2-3 , pp. 142-151
    • Götz, J.1    Iglberger, K.2    Feichtinger, C.3    Donath, S.4    Rüde, U.5
  • 5
    • 77549086130 scopus 로고    scopus 로고
    • Numerical simulation of nanoparticles in Brownian motion using the Lattice Boltzmann method
    • Diploma Thesis, July
    • P. Neumann, Numerical simulation of nanoparticles in Brownian motion using the Lattice Boltzmann method, Diploma Thesis, July 2008.
    • (2008)
    • Neumann, P.1
  • 7
    • 79958767879 scopus 로고    scopus 로고
    • Entwicklung eines Parallelen, Adaptiven, Komponentenbasierten Strömungskerns für Hierarchische Gitter auf Basis des Lattice-Boltzmann-Verfahrens, Ph.D. Thesis, University Carolo-Wilhelmina, Braunschweig
    • S. Freudiger, Entwicklung eines Parallelen, Adaptiven, Komponentenbasierten Strömungskerns für Hierarchische Gitter auf Basis des Lattice-Boltzmann-Verfahrens, Ph.D. Thesis, University Carolo-Wilhelmina, Braunschweig, 2009.
    • (2009)
    • Freudiger, S.1
  • 10
    • 79958765288 scopus 로고    scopus 로고
    • Palabos, Available at
    • Palabos Information on the Palabos Project February 2010, Available at http://www.lbmethod.org/palabos/index.html/.
    • (2010) Information on the Palabos Project
  • 14
    • 0001968281 scopus 로고
    • A spiral model of software development and enhancement
    • Boehm B. A spiral model of software development and enhancement. ACM SIGSOFT Software Engineering Notes 1986, 11(4):14-24.
    • (1986) ACM SIGSOFT Software Engineering Notes , vol.11 , Issue.4 , pp. 14-24
    • Boehm, B.1
  • 16
    • 0038359301 scopus 로고    scopus 로고
    • Viscous flow computation with the method of Lattice Boltzmann equation
    • Yu D., Mei R., Luo L.-S., Shyy W. Viscous flow computation with the method of Lattice Boltzmann equation. Progress in Aerospace Sciences 2003, 39(5):329-367.
    • (2003) Progress in Aerospace Sciences , vol.39 , Issue.5 , pp. 329-367
    • Yu, D.1    Mei, R.2    Luo, L.-S.3    Shyy, W.4
  • 18
    • 41349099628 scopus 로고    scopus 로고
    • Single relaxation time model for entropic Lattice Boltzmann methods
    • Ansumali S., Karlin I. Single relaxation time model for entropic Lattice Boltzmann methods. Physical Review E 2002, 65(2-3):056312.
    • (2002) Physical Review E , vol.65 , Issue.2-3 , pp. 056312
    • Ansumali, S.1    Karlin, I.2
  • 19
    • 33745326575 scopus 로고    scopus 로고
    • Cascaded digital Lattice Boltzmann automaton for high reynolds number flows
    • Geier M., Greiner A., Korvink J.G. Cascaded digital Lattice Boltzmann automaton for high reynolds number flows. Physical Review E 2006, 73(6):066705.
    • (2006) Physical Review E , vol.73 , Issue.6 , pp. 066705
    • Geier, M.1    Greiner, A.2    Korvink, J.G.3
  • 21
    • 70350681368 scopus 로고    scopus 로고
    • High performance simulation of free surface flows using the Lattice Boltzmann method
    • Ph.D. Thesis, FAU, July
    • T. Pohl, High performance simulation of free surface flows using the Lattice Boltzmann method, Ph.D. Thesis, FAU, July 2008, http://www10.informatik.uni-erlangen.de/de/Publications/Dissertations/.
    • (2008)
    • Pohl, T.1
  • 24
    • 56349098815 scopus 로고    scopus 로고
    • A comparative study of immersed-boundary and interpolated bounce-back methods in LBE
    • Peng L.-S.L.Y. A comparative study of immersed-boundary and interpolated bounce-back methods in LBE. Progress in Computational Fluid Dynamics 2008, 8(1-4):156-167.
    • (2008) Progress in Computational Fluid Dynamics , vol.8 , Issue.1-4 , pp. 156-167
    • Peng, L.-S.L.Y.1
  • 25
    • 78650814173 scopus 로고    scopus 로고
    • Direct Numerical Simulation of Particulate Flows on 294912 Processor Cores In: IEEE computer society: ACM/IEEE International Conference for High Performance Computing, Networking, Storage and Analysis (Supercomputing'10, New Orleans, 13.11. -19.11.2010). 2010
    • J. Götz, K. Iglberger, M. Stürmer, U. Rüde: Direct Numerical Simulation of Particulate Flows on 294912 Processor Cores In: IEEE computer society: 2010 ACM/IEEE International Conference for High Performance Computing, Networking, Storage and Analysis (Supercomputing'10, New Orleans, 13.11. -19.11.2010). 2010, S. 1-11 - ISBN 978-1-4244r-r7559-9.
    • (2010)
    • Götz, J.1    Iglberger, K.2    Stürmer, M.3    Rüde, U.4
  • 26
    • 79958772175 scopus 로고    scopus 로고
    • Available at
    • OpenCL Information on OpenCL February 2010, Available at http://www.khronos.org/opencl/.
    • (2010) OpenCL Information on OpenCL
  • 27
    • 33646809359 scopus 로고    scopus 로고
    • On the single processor performance of simple Lattice Boltzmann kernels
    • ISSN 0045-7930
    • Wellein G., Zeiser T., Hager G., Donath S. On the single processor performance of simple Lattice Boltzmann kernels. Computers & Fluids 2006, 35(8-9):910-919. ISSN 0045-7930.
    • (2006) Computers & Fluids , vol.35 , Issue.8-9 , pp. 910-919
    • Wellein, G.1    Zeiser, T.2    Hager, G.3    Donath, S.4
  • 31
    • 67650080041 scopus 로고    scopus 로고
    • Measuring the software product quality during the software development life-cycle: an international organization for standardization standards perspective
    • Al-Qutaish R.E. Measuring the software product quality during the software development life-cycle: an international organization for standardization standards perspective. Journal of Computer Science 2009, 5(5):392-397.
    • (2009) Journal of Computer Science , vol.5 , Issue.5 , pp. 392-397
    • Al-Qutaish, R.E.1
  • 34
    • 79958767207 scopus 로고    scopus 로고
    • Subversion, Available at
    • Subversion Information on Subversion February 2010, Available at http://subversion.apache.org/.
    • (2010) Information on Subversion
  • 36
    • 79958765948 scopus 로고    scopus 로고
    • CMake, Available at
    • CMake Information on CMake February 2010, Available at http://www.cmake.org/.
    • (2010) Information on CMake
  • 37
    • 79958768378 scopus 로고    scopus 로고
    • Information available at
    • Woodcrest Cluster February 2010, Information available at http://www.rrze.uni-erlangen.de/.
    • (2010) Woodcrest Cluster
  • 38
    • 79958770978 scopus 로고    scopus 로고
    • Information available at
    • HLRB II February 2010, Information available at http://www.lrz-muenchen.de/english/index.html/.
    • (2010) HLRB II
  • 39
    • 79958768887 scopus 로고    scopus 로고
    • Information available at
    • Juropa and Jugene February 2010, Information available at http://fz-juelich.de/nic/.
    • (2010) Juropa and Jugene
  • 40
    • 79958765529 scopus 로고    scopus 로고
    • Data locality optimizations for iterative numerical algorithms and cellular automata on hierarchical memory architectures,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g, Advances in Simulation 13, June
    • M. Kowarschik, Data locality optimizations for iterative numerical algorithms and cellular automata on hierarchical memory architectures,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g, Advances in Simulation 13, June 2004.
    • (2004)
    • Kowarschik, M.1
  • 41
    • 79958767705 scopus 로고    scopus 로고
    • Efficiency improvements of iterative numerical algorithms on modern architectures,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g
    • J. Treibig, Efficiency improvements of iterative numerical algorithms on modern architectures,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g, 2008.
    • (2008)
    • Treibig, J.1
  • 44
    • 79958768980 scopus 로고    scopus 로고
    • Hierarchical hybrid grids: data structures and core algorithms for efficient finite element simulations on supercomputers,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g
    • B. Bergen, Hierarchical hybrid grids: data structures and core algorithms for efficient finite element simulations on supercomputers, Ph.D. Thesis, Friedrich-Alexander-University Erlangen-Nuremberg, 2005.
    • (2005)
    • Bergen, B.1


* 이 정보는 Elsevier사의 SCOPUS DB에서 KISTI가 분석하여 추출한 것입니다.